Variations in histamine concentration in nasal secretion in patients with allergic rhinitis.

Abstract

The histamine concentration and content in nasal secretion and the volume of nasal secretion in nasal washing samples were measured under different conditions in 28 patients with allergic rhinitis sensitive to birch pollen. The mean histamine concentration was significantly lower after intranasal birch pollen challenge (2.08 micrograms/ml) than in prechallenge samples (6.96 micrograms/ml), and was also significantly lower in untreated patients during the birch pollen season (2.30 micrograms/ml) than off-season (7.18 micrograms/ml). The same relationship was found between the histamine content of the secretion samples obtained on these occasions. The mean secretion volume was greater after than before challenge, but not significantly higher during the season than off-season. A partial reversion of the changes in histamine concentration and content that occurred during the season was observed during intranasal corticosteroid therapy. The concentration and content of histamine in nasal secretion from symptomatic patients after intranasal histamine challenge did not differ significantly from those in asymptomatic subjects before challenge. It was concluded that although the histamine level in nasal secretion can be used as a marker of changes in the severity of allergic rhinitis, it is not ideal for this purpose.

在28例对桦树花粉过敏的变应性鼻炎患者中,于不同条件下测量鼻腔冲洗样本中鼻分泌物的组胺浓度、含量及鼻分泌物量。鼻内给予桦树花粉激发后,组胺平均浓度(2.08微克/毫升)显著低于激发前样本(6.96微克/毫升),且在桦树花粉季节未治疗患者中的组胺平均浓度(2.30微克/毫升)也显著低于非花粉季节(7.18微克/毫升)。在这些情况下获得的分泌物样本的组胺含量之间也发现了相同的关系。激发后分泌物平均量大于激发前,但在花粉季节并不显著高于非花粉季节。在鼻内使用皮质类固醇治疗期间,观察到季节期间组胺浓度和含量变化的部分逆转。鼻内组胺激发后有症状患者鼻分泌物中组胺的浓度和含量与激发前无症状受试者的浓度和含量无显著差异。得出的结论是,虽然鼻分泌物中的组胺水平可作为变应性鼻炎严重程度变化的标志物,但用于此目的并不理想。
